This is the third round of a conference aimed at showcasing the most "noble" approaches of circular economy: reuse, durability and repairability and, logically, eco-design.
This year we will focus on the textile sector. We will showcase real examples of companies that have successfully applied one or more of those approaches: “The heroes”. We want to demonstrate through real stories, that reusing and repairing not only contribute to a more sustainable economic development, but they can also be business opportunities. We hope those stories will be a source of inspiration for many others.
The event is organized in a talk-show format and audience will actively participate in the discussion.
